dhouse Posted March 24, 2008 Report Share Posted March 24, 2008 Hello I have a 2006 Chevrolet Silverado 2500HD w/ factory XM and steering wheel controls. After installation of the Avic D2, the factory steering wheel controls no longer worked. Is there a modification that I need to make to get these to work again? Also, there was not a connection for my factory XM harness. Is there a conversion plug available for this as well? I also did not find an orange wire on my harness for the illumination wire. I was able to hook up the dimmer wire. Will this be a problem without the orange wire hooked up? Thanks, Dustin. Quote Link to post Share on other sites
whtcrxghst Posted March 24, 2008 Report Share Posted March 24, 2008 You will have to buy an adaptor for the steering wheel controls to work. You will also have to buy the Pioneer XM tuner for the XM to work, the model is GEXP920XM (non-traffic) or GEXP10XMT (NavTraffic model) Quote Link to post Share on other sites
